这里有一点不明白

来源:3-11 编程练习

上心4409406

2019-11-16 09:00:57

var str = '192.168.1.1@Admin';

var pattern=/\d\.\d\W\w\w\w\w\w/;

    document.write(pattern.exec(str));


上节课讲的只匹配第一个字符 我这么写应该只输出1啊 怎么全都输出了

写回答

1回答

好帮手慕言

2019-11-16

同学你好,这样写是可以实现本次编程题的效果,正则匹配的内容如下:

http://img.mukewang.com/climg/5dcf6f8909e0651406350268.jpg

如果是输出1,那么可以按照下面的方式书写,代码参考:
http://img.mukewang.com/climg/5dcf6f0209d320be04720179.jpg

同学可以测试下,祝学习愉快~

0

0 学习 · 14456 问题

查看课程